Which is correct ten minutes is too long or ten minutes are too long?

Ten minutes is too long ( a time). The sentence Ten minutes are too long means that ten of the minutes are longer than the others.

Is this sentence correct This is with reference to the email hereunder regarding wrong charging on your?

Well, it may be correct (even if incomplete) but much too convoluted. Business correspondence (even emails) should be simple and straightforward. For example: In response to the attached email regarding incorrect charges to your...
